𝗪𝗵𝗮𝘁 𝗮𝗿𝗲 𝗦𝗻𝗮𝗰𝗸 𝗙𝗼𝗼𝗱 𝗣𝗿𝗼𝗰𝗲𝘀𝘀𝗶𝗻𝗴 𝗠𝗮𝗰𝗵𝗶𝗻𝗲𝘀?
Snack Food Processing Machines are specialized equipment designed for the production and processing of various snack foods. These machines automate processes such as frying, baking, drying, and packaging, ensuring efficiency and consistency in snack production. They are essential for manufacturers looking to scale operations while maintaining quality and reducing labor costs.
These machines are widely used in industries producing potato chips, popcorn, nuts, granola bars, and other snack items. By utilizing advanced technology, they help businesses streamline their production lines, improve food safety, and enhance product quality. 𝗣𝗿𝗼𝗱𝘂𝗰𝘁 𝗩𝗮𝗿𝗶𝗮𝗻𝘁𝘀 𝗮𝗻𝗱 𝗦𝘂𝗯𝗰𝗮𝘁𝗲𝗴𝗼𝗿𝗶𝗲𝘀
Snack Food Processing Machines come in various types to cater to different production needs.
Frying Machines
These machines are designed for deep frying snacks such as chips and fries. They provide precise temperature control and oil circulation for consistent frying results.
Baking Ovens
Baking ovens are used for producing baked snacks like crackers and cookies. They feature adjustable settings for temperature and time, ensuring uniform baking.
Extruders
Extruders are used for creating snacks by forcing dough through a shaped die. This process is crucial for producing items like puffed snacks and cereal.
Packaging Machines
These machines automate the packaging of finished snacks, ensuring they are securely sealed and labeled for retail.

𝗖𝗼𝗺𝗽𝗹𝗶𝗮𝗻𝗰𝗲 𝗮𝗻𝗱 𝗖𝗲𝗿𝘁𝗶𝗳𝗶𝗰𝗮𝘁𝗶𝗼𝗻𝘀
Snack Food Processing Machines must adhere to various quality and safety standards.
ISO 9001 is a widely recognized standard for quality management systems, ensuring that manufacturers maintain consistent quality in their production processes.
HACCP (Hazard Analysis Critical Control Point) is a crucial system for managing food safety. Machines designed with HACCP compliance can help ensure that food products are safe from contamination.
CE certification indicates that products meet European safety standards. This certification is essential for machines sold in the European market.
Safety and testing requirements may also include performance testing and maintenance guidelines to ensure that machines operate within safe parameters.
Regional compliance considerations may vary, so it is vital for manufacturers to be aware of local regulations affecting food processing equipment.
